Luxembourg Flag Meaning & Details
125 VISITORS FROM HERE! Luxembourg Flag |
 |
Flag Information |
- three equal horizontal bands of red (top), white, and light blue
- similar to the flag of the Netherlands, which uses a darker blue and is shorter
- the coloring is derived from the Grand Duke's coat of arms (a red lion on a white and blue striped field)
